The differing immune system responses of patients with COVID-19 can help predict who will experience moderate and severe consequences of disease, according to a new study by Yale researchers published July 27 in the journal Nature.
The findings may help identify individuals at high risk of severe illness early in their hospitalization and suggest drugs to treat COVID-19.
